Index: src/utils/debugger/SkDebugCanvas.cpp |
diff --git a/src/utils/debugger/SkDebugCanvas.cpp b/src/utils/debugger/SkDebugCanvas.cpp |
index 63739aee814a41a1a4b338d6009590f20eec56d8..0f837594ce205de44abf88e0be3373a92ade1e72 100644 |
--- a/src/utils/debugger/SkDebugCanvas.cpp |
+++ b/src/utils/debugger/SkDebugCanvas.cpp |
@@ -12,6 +12,7 @@ |
#include "SkDevice.h" |
#include "SkPaintFilterCanvas.h" |
#include "SkXfermode.h" |
+#include "SkValue.h" |
namespace { |
@@ -54,6 +55,10 @@ public: |
#ifndef SK_IGNORE_TO_STRING |
void toString(SkString* str) const override { str->set("OverdrawXfermode"); } |
#endif |
+ |
+ SkValue asValue() const override { |
+ return SkValue::Object(SkValue::OverdrawXfermode); |
+ } |
}; |
mtklein
2016/01/15 00:25:22
Let's not bother with this xfermode. We don't ser
hal.canary
2016/01/15 13:38:56
done
|
class DebugPaintFilterCanvas : public SkPaintFilterCanvas { |